Are premiums paid for medical insurance deductable medical expenses?

This is for after tax premiums for medical insurance, and I understand that the only the amount greater than 7.5% of income is considered deductible.

    As long as you paid them with after-tax money.

    I can’t deduct mine as I did them pre-tax through work.

    In the Pub 17, it says, “Medical expenses include the premiums you pay for insurance that covers the expenses of medical care, and the amounts you pay for transportation to get medical care.” So as long as you pay for the medical insurance, you are allow to take that deduction.
